What is the digital signature legitimateness for shipping in the European Union
The digital signature legitimateness for shipping in the European Union refers to the legal recognition of electronic signatures in the context of shipping documents. Under the eIDAS Regulation, electronic signatures are considered equivalent to handwritten signatures, provided they meet specific requirements. This legitimateness ensures that documents signed digitally are enforceable and can be used in legal proceedings, facilitating smoother cross-border shipping operations within the EU.

Legal use of the digital signature legitimateness for shipping in the European Union
The legal use of digital signatures for shipping in the European Union is governed by the eIDAS Regulation, which establishes the framework for electronic signatures. This regulation outlines the criteria for valid electronic signatures, including the necessity for a secure signature creation device and the ability to verify the signer's identity. Businesses must adhere to these legal standards to ensure their digital signatures are enforceable in legal contexts.

Examples of using the digital signature legitimateness for shipping in the European Union
Examples of using digital signature legitimateness for shipping include:
- Signing bills of lading electronically, ensuring quick processing and legal validity.
- Approving shipping contracts through secure digital signatures, reducing delays.
- Sending customs declarations with digital signatures to streamline cross-border shipments.
These examples demonstrate how digital signatures enhance efficiency and legal compliance in shipping operations.
